    bnc#862514: Handle corner case in slide sorter correctly. · a24e9c29

    We should never return -1 when bIncludeBordersAndGaps is true; but that could
    have happened in a corner case:
    
    * export SAL_USE_VCLPLUGIN=gen
    * start LibreOffice
    * open a presentation with many slides
    * resize the window so that it shows the slides _exactly_, no slide is cut
      off in the slide sorter
    * point the mouse pointer into the left "Slides" sidebar (slide sorter) so
      that it does not cause any mouse-over effect (somehow between the left
      border, and the slides - there is space that can do this)
    * turn the mouse wheel all the way down so that the last slide is at the
      bottom
    * turn the mouse wheel up _once_
    * turn the mouse wheel down _once_ - it will look like the view does not
      change (the last but one is still at the bottom), but you can see the
      scrollbar jump to the top
    * and now you can again start turning the wheel all the way down to repeat
      the procedure :-)
